It was initially designed as a mod originally designed for Half-Life the game quickly became a hit and developed into a separate franchise. It became the most played online shooter that is based on teamwork, and is credited with setting new standards in the genre. Its innovative gameplay, and design options, have been used by countless first-person shooter multi-player games. The franchise has also spawned a number of spin-offs including an arcade game that has an anime theme called Counter-Strike Neo.

In 2004 Counter-Strike Source was released, which utilized Valve's Source engine was released. The major overhaul of the original game was released in 2004. The latest version included updated graphics, two unique single-player campaigns, and many other improvements. This made the game even more popular than it had been before. Hidden Path Entertainment also ported the game to Mac OS X as well as the Xbox 360 consoles.

The CS:GO competition scene started at local LANs, and eventually became an international phenomenon. Its popularity led to development of a series events called "Major" tournaments. These tournaments offer huge prize pools and attract professional teams from around the globe. They also inspire teams and players to develop their skills.
